"use strict"; Object.defineProperty(exports, "__esModule", { value: true }); exports.Frame = void 0; const constants_1 = require("./constants"); class Frame { type; subsystem; commandID; data; length; fcs; constructor(type, subsystem, commandID, data, length, fcs) { this.type = type; this.subsystem = subsystem; this.commandID = commandID; this.data = data; this.length = length; this.fcs = fcs; } toBuffer() { const length = this.data.length; const cmd0 = ((this.type << 5) & 0xe0) | (this.subsystem & 0x1f); let payload = Buffer.from([constants_1.SOF, length, cmd0, this.commandID]); payload = Buffer.concat([payload, this.data]); const fcs = Frame.calculateChecksum(payload.slice(1, payload.length)); return Buffer.concat([payload, Buffer.from([fcs])]); } static fromBuffer(length, fcsPosition, buffer) { const subsystem = buffer.readUInt8(constants_1.PositionCmd0) & 0x1f; const type = (buffer.readUInt8(constants_1.PositionCmd0) & 0xe0) >> 5; const commandID = buffer.readUInt8(constants_1.PositionCmd1); const data = buffer.subarray(constants_1.DataStart, fcsPosition); const fcs = buffer.readUInt8(fcsPosition); // Validate the checksum to see if we fully received the message const checksum = Frame.calculateChecksum(buffer.subarray(1, fcsPosition)); if (checksum === fcs) { return new Frame(type, subsystem, commandID, data, length, fcs); } throw new Error("Invalid checksum"); } static calculateChecksum(values) { let checksum = 0; for (const value of values) { checksum ^= value; } return checksum; } toString() { return `${this.length} - ${this.type} - ${this.subsystem} - ${this.commandID} - [${[...this.data]}] - ${this.fcs}`; } } exports.Frame = Frame; //# sourceMappingURL=frame.js.map
